>  I am using KDB 1.2 for debugging kernel loadable modules, but on using 
>the command "bt" (Stack Backtrace)of the debugger, KDB shows only the 
>functions of the kernel and is not able to show the functions in the
>kernel module. The debugger shows the function call of the module as
>"unknown".

kdb 1.2 is hopelessly out of date and has poor module support.  Upgrade
to a more recent kdb from ftp://oss.sgi.com/projects/kdb/download.  And
before you ask, SGI are not maintaining kdb for 2.2 kernels, only for
2.4.
